Tesla settles 2019 California crash lawsuit ahead of jury trial

Tesla reached a confidential settlement to end a lawsuit over a teenager’s death in a 2019 California crash involving its Model 3 on Autopilot. The agreement was revealed in a court order and came ahead of a scheduled jury trial. No further details on the settlement terms have been made public.

Background of the Crash

Tesla faced legal action over a 2019 crash in California that claimed the life of a teenager. The lawsuit centered on the circumstances leading up to the accident and how the vehicle’s systems may have played a role.

Autopilot and the Lawsuit

Autopilot, Tesla’s advanced driver assistance software, was reportedly active in the Model 3 when the crash occurred. This feature, designed to assist drivers through semi-automated steering, braking, and acceleration, has been cited in discussions about the technology’s capabilities and limitations.

The Confidential Settlement

A recent court order disclosed that Tesla “reached a confidential deal to resolve a lawsuit over a teenager’s death,” concluding the legal process before moving to a public trial. The terms remain undisclosed, reflecting similar patterns in other high-profile automotive settlements.

Significance of the Timing

The settlement was finalized before a jury could examine the facts in court. While this avoids the uncertainty of a trial, it also means further details, including any admissions or larger ramifications for Tesla’s driver assistance technology, remain unpublished.
